Schedule:
-FRIDAY: Meet at scheduled location full of fuel, food and booze, depart from Alberni and head west. Henderson was such a nice spot last year that I thought we would go there first. There are many routes into the Nahmint/Henderson area, so lets make it a race, everyone for themselves . or enjoy each others company / dust and find some wicked spots along the way!
-SATURDAY: From Henderson we will carry on west, Snow Creek main takes us along the south side of Sprout Lake and reconnects with Highway 4. along Highway 4 there are a number of Logging roads that take off and head every which way. one in particular I thought we would try is right near the summit of Suttons Pass. some spotty Facebook knowledge leads me to believe there is a nice river campsite North of the Highway. There is also apparently a cabin worth checking out up in the hills on the opposite side that is only accessible a couple month of the year due to snow.
Mapbooks will be out on Friday night planning Saturday.
-SUNDAY: Rise and shine from whatever location we end up at and yes....carry on West. We'll push down to Kennedy Lake and either head North or south. North will eventually lead us to Virgin Falls, along the way we pass Kennedy Lake, Muriel Lake and then follow Tofino inlet to the falls. Berryman Cove in a nice spot to stay, an old Log sort, now somewhat abandoned makes for flat camping, oceanfront, and relatively warm water. Issues with this area is how busy it may be over the long weekend, but its worth a shot.
South takes us towards toquart Bay/salmon beach/Barkeley Sound. we can also head past toquart bay and up to Toquart lake possibly. I've never been up that way but have always wanted to.
-MONDAY: Official end to the trip, head away when you see fit. I have that entire week off and am currently heading North towards Cape scott as a tentative end point, though may spend some time in the Campbell River/woss Area. Anyone is Welcome to carry on the trip with me for however long.
